UBC Chemistry is committed to ensuring that our department is an equitable and inclusive environment in which all students, faculty, and staff can thrive. Equity, diversity, and inclusion (EDI) underpin excellence in education and research; the department members have a shared responsibility to uphold a high standard of EDI in the workplace.
We acknowledge that we work on the traditional, ancestral, and unceded territory of the Musqueam people, in a place where work and learning have always been part of a way of life. We reflect on this as we work, and learn from our work and each other.
Goals of Chemistry EDI Committee
The efforts of this committee are geared towards fostering a safe and respectful environment in which to pursue scholarship, where everyone feels they belong as a valued member. We aim to advise the department on ways to create a welcoming, inclusive community, and on identifying and incorporating best practices for equity and diversity within our policies, procedures, and practices. Events organized by the EDI committee will be advertised on the Chemistry Department upcoming event list. In addition, the website for the graduate student group, Chemists for Diversity and Inclusion (CDI) has an updated calendar for EDI events across campus.
